- Shikhar AgrawalJun 30, 2022 · 3 years agoPrice elasticity is a crucial factor in determining the value of cryptocurrencies. When the price of a cryptocurrency is highly elastic, even small changes in demand can lead to significant price fluctuations. This means that the value of the cryptocurrency can be highly volatile and subject to rapid changes. On the other hand, when the price elasticity is low, the value of the cryptocurrency is more stable and less affected by changes in demand. Overall, price elasticity plays a vital role in shaping the market dynamics of cryptocurrencies.
- isiya usmanJul 31, 2023 · 2 years agoPrice elasticity and its impact on the value of cryptocurrencies can be compared to the concept of supply and demand in traditional markets. When the price of a cryptocurrency is highly elastic, it means that the market is sensitive to changes in demand. As a result, even a slight increase in demand can lead to a significant price increase, and vice versa. This high price elasticity can make cryptocurrencies attractive for short-term traders looking to profit from price fluctuations. However, it also poses risks for investors as the value of the cryptocurrency can quickly decline. Therefore, understanding the price elasticity of cryptocurrencies is crucial for both traders and long-term investors.
